Can Chinese Evergreen Grow Outside?

The Chinese Evergreen, known scientifically as Aglaonema, is a highly favored, decorative houseplant prized for its striking, variegated foliage and remarkable adaptability to indoor conditions. Originating in the tropical and subtropical regions of Southeast Asia, this plant naturally thrives beneath a dense canopy, which explains its reputation as a tolerant, low-light specimen. Many gardeners are interested in transitioning their Chinese Evergreens outdoors to benefit from the natural light and humidity of the warmer seasons, or even to grow them as a permanent landscape feature. Determining the outdoor viability of Aglaonema depends almost entirely on regional climate conditions.

Understanding Temperature Tolerance

The feasibility of growing Chinese Evergreen outdoors year-round is strictly limited by its tropical origin and poor tolerance for cold. Aglaonema species are best suited for permanent outdoor planting only in the warmest regions, specifically USDA Hardiness Zones 10B through 11B, where frost is exceedingly rare or nonexistent. In these locations, the plant can function as a perennial groundcover or specimen plant, provided it receives appropriate shade protection.

The survival of the Chinese Evergreen hinges on maintaining temperatures above a specific threshold. These plants prefer a consistently warm environment, ideally between 65°F and 80°F, which mimics their native habitat. They begin to experience significant stress when temperatures drop below 60°F. Exposure below 50°F causes visible chilling injury, often manifesting as dark, water-soaked patches or yellowing leaves. Since most of the country regularly experiences temperatures below this minimum, the Chinese Evergreen is generally cultivated as a temporary summer accent or strictly as an indoor container plant.

Ideal Outdoor Environmental Needs

When the temperature range is suitable, Chinese Evergreens require specific environmental conditions to thrive outside. They are accustomed to receiving filtered light, which must be replicated outdoors. Direct, unfiltered sunlight will quickly scorch the plant’s delicate leaves, especially cultivars with lighter or more colorful variegation.

The ideal placement is in a location that receives bright, indirect light or full shade, such as under a dense tree canopy or on a north-facing porch. A well-draining soil medium is necessary to prevent root rot, as the plant is highly susceptible if left in standing water. The soil should be rich in organic matter and remain consistently moist. The Chinese Evergreen also favors high humidity, doing best when levels are maintained above 60%, which summer outdoor exposure often provides naturally.

Managing Seasonal Transitions

For gardeners living outside the perpetually warm Zones 10B-11B, moving the Chinese Evergreen outdoors for the summer requires careful timing and preparation. The plant should not be moved outside until all risk of frost has passed and nighttime temperatures are reliably stable above 60°F, with 65°F being a safer minimum for sustained outdoor residence. Moving the plant out too early risks significant cold shock, which can severely damage the plant’s health.

The transition process must be gradual to prevent light shock, a procedure known as hardening off. The plant should first be placed in a deeply shaded, protected spot for several days, receiving only morning sun or filtered light. This slow introduction allows the foliage to adjust its cellular structure to the increased light intensity and ultraviolet exposure, preventing the immediate leaf burn that occurs with sudden exposure.

Before returning the Aglaonema indoors for the winter, typically when temperatures drop below 60°F, a thorough pest inspection is mandatory. Common outdoor pests like spider mites or mealybugs can easily hitch a ride back inside and infest other houseplants. Treating the plant with insecticidal soap or horticultural oil, and manually cleaning the leaves and stems, should be done before placing it back indoors. Adjusting the watering schedule to account for lower light and slower growth is the final step in preparing the plant for winter dormancy.
